Vivo T4 Ultra vs Samsung Galaxy A56 5G: Processor

Vivo T4 Ultra boasts the MediaTek Dimensity 9300 Plus processor running at a maximum speed of 3.25GHz. It is accompanied by 8GB RAM and another 8GB virtual RAM for quick app opening, seamless gaming, and untimely multitasking.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G, however, has the Exynos 1580 chipset running at 2.9GHz. While efficient, it cannot compete with Vivo when it comes to sheer power. Samsung also has 8GB RAM, but without virtual RAM support.

Vivo T4 Ultra vs Samsung Galaxy A56 5G: Display and Battery

Vivo T4 Ultra boasts a 6.67-inch AMOLED screen with sharp 1260×2800 resolution and 460ppi pixel density. It is augmented by P3 Wide Color Gamut, HDR, 120Hz refresh rate, and 300Hz touch sampling rate, making it firmly placed when it comes to visual quality.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G possesses a slightly larger 6.7-inch Super AMOLED display but only offers 1080×2340 resolution and 385ppi. The brightness goes up to 1200 nits with Gorilla Glass Victus+ protection. In battery, Vivo offers 5500mAh with 90W fast charging, while Samsung offers 5000mAh and 45W charging. Vivo also offers a reverse charging feature, an extra bit of convenience.

Vivo T4 Ultra vs Samsung Galaxy A56 5G: Camera

Vivo T4 Ultra boasts a powerful triple camera setup on the back 50MP main, 50MP 3x periscope, and 8MP ultra-wide, equipped with Sony IMX921 and IMX882 sensors. 4K video capture and a 32MP front camera offer high-quality detail to selfies and photographs.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G boasts a triple back with a 50MP primary, 12MP ultra-wide, and 5MP macro. The front has a 12MP camera. While Samsung offers mid-level performance, Vivo edges by a very small margin in sharpness, zoom, and selfies.

Price of Vivo T4 Ultra and Samsung Galaxy A56 5G

Vivo T4 Ultra comes at ₹37,999 on Flipkart. Samsung Galaxy A56 5G keeps it at ₹38,999 on Amazon, Croma, and Samsung’s website.
